Freepik
    landscape of Beautiful Wild Himalayan Cherry Blooming pink Prunus cerasoides flowers at Phu Lom Lo Loei and Phitsanulok of Thailand

    Landscape of Beautiful Wild Himalayan Cherry Blooming pink Prunus cerasoides flowers at Phu Lom Lo Loei and Phitsanulok of Thailand